Why do so many coconut trees grow near the ocean?

Social Studies
2 answers:
Evgesh-ka [11]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Coconuts have a high water requirement. So it is easier for them to grow in those areas. In non-coastal regions the high necessity of water is matched by using coco peat near the roots of coconut trees, so that the water stays near the root for a long time.

John is participating in a study and is asked if he would stop and help someone whose car has broken down on the freeway. John a
HACTEHA [7]

Answer: Demand characteristics.

Explanation:

Demand characteristics are the traits shown by participant of the research and experiment  in which they behave according to the expectancy of researcher or experiment so that aim of the research can be accomplished .This creates biasness in research process and decrease validity of the experiment.

According to the question, John's positive reply to the situation where someone need helps if his/her car is broken displays the impact of demand characteristics .In actuality , he would probably not help the person by stopping and he just answered in positive manner to support the study.Thus, the reply is biased.
